Forecast: Acute Myocardial Infarction Mortality in Japan

The mortality rate from acute myocardial infarction among women in Japan is forecasted to decline significantly from 2024 to 2028. The values indicate a steady decrease from 6.2 deaths per 100,000 women in 2024 to 4.2 in 2028. Considering the trend, a notable year-on-year reduction can be observed: 8.1% from 2024 to 2025, 8.8% from 2025 to 2026, 9.6% from 2026 to 2027, and 10.6% from 2027 to 2028.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) between 2024 and 2028 is approximately -9.3%.
